Blockchain
Because a good decentralized system, bitcoin works rather than a main power otherwise unmarried officer, [ 76 ] to ensure that you can now would a different sort of bitcoin target and you can transact without needing one acceptance. [ 6 ] : ch. one They do this thanks to an expert distributed ledger called a great http://bitkingzslots.com/nl blockchain that records bitcoin deals. [ 77 ] The new blockchain is adopted because a purchased variety of blocks. For every cut off includes a great SHA-256 hash of one’s previous take off, [ 77 ] chaining all of them during the chronological purchase. [ 6 ] : ch. seven [ 77 ] The fresh new blockchain try handled by an equal-to-fellow community. [ 29 ] : 215�219 Private blocks, personal contact, and you will deals within this prevents try public information, and can end up being checked out having fun with a blockchain explorer. [ 78 ] Nodes verify and you can broadcast deals, per keeping a duplicate of one’s blockchain to possess ownership confirmation. [ 79 ] A different sort of cut off is done the 10 minutes typically, upgrading the fresh new blockchain all over every nodes instead of central supervision. Instead of a traditional ledger you to songs real currency, bitcoins exists electronically since the unspent outputs from transactions. [ six ] : ch. 5
Contact and you may transactions
Basic strings of possession. In practice, a purchase can have more than one type in and more than one to returns. [ 80 ] In the blockchain, bitcoins is actually linked to certain chain entitled address. Oftentimes, a message encodes a good hash of 1 societal key. Performing including an address pertains to creating a haphazard private key and you may following calculating the brand new relevant address. This course of action is nearly quick, nevertheless the opposite (locating the personal secret to have certain address) is nearly hopeless. [ 6 ] : ch. 4 Publishing for example an effective bitcoin address doesn’t risk the private key, and it is unlikely so you’re able to accidentally generate an effective used secret which have financing. To utilize bitcoins, citizens need their personal key to electronically signal purchases, which can be verified of the community by using the social key, keeping the private trick miracle. [ six ] : ch. 5 An address could possibly get encode the newest hash out of an effective bitcoin software you to definitely specifies more complicated conditions to blow money. A standard analogy are “multisig”, in which numerous distinctive line of personal secrets must mutually sign people deal one to tries to spend fund. [ 6 ] : ch. 7 Bitcoin purchases use a forth-including scripting words, [ 6 ] : ch. 5 of a minumum of one inputs and you may outputs. Whenever delivering bitcoins, a person specifies the latest recipients’ addresses and the number for every single returns. This permits giving bitcoins to a lot of receiver in one single deal. To end double-investing, for each input need refer to a previous unspent output on the blockchain. [ 80 ] Playing with numerous inputs is like having fun with several coins inside an effective bucks purchase. As with a funds purchase, the sum of enters can be exceed the fresh new intended amount of payments. In such a case, an additional yields can be get back the alteration back again to the latest payer. [ 80 ] Unallocated type in satoshis from the transaction end up being the exchange fee. [ 80 ] Dropping a personal key function dropping the means to access the fresh bitcoins, without almost every other evidence of ownership acknowledged by protocol. [ 29 ] For instance, during the 2013, a person shed ?7,five hundred, cherished during the United states$eight.5 billion, of the eventually discarding a difficult push to the personal secret. [ 81 ] Approximately doing 20% of the many bitcoins is shed. [ 82 ] The private key must become kept secret as its publicity, such as as a consequence of a data breach, can cause thieves of your related bitcoins. [ six ] : ch. ten [ 83 ] Since [update] , up to ?980,000 ended up being taken away from cryptocurrency transfers. [ 84 ]